Chem. ? Obs. [ad. F. zoogène: see ZOO- and -GEN.] A nitrogenous substance found in the water of sulphur-springs; also called BAREGIN or GLAIRIN.

1820.  Blackw. Mag., March, 710. Mineral Animal Matter—Zoogene.—Sig. Carlo di Gimbernat has discovered a peculiar substance in the thermal waters of Baden and of Ischia.
